Former British player Laura Robson has highlighted one reason behind Joao Fonseca’s behind impressive performances in the recent past. The 18-year-old is already regarded as one for the future.

He recent featured in the Argentina Open and lifted the competition after beating local favourite Francisco Cerundolo in straight sets with a score of 6-4, 7-6. His most recent appearance came in the Rio Open where he lost in the first round to Alexandre Muller in straight sets with a score of 6-1, 7-6.

Former British player Robson has recently written a column for Sky Sports, in which she explained her point of view about a number of players. She specifically spoke about Fonseca and explained why she has been his ‘big fan’. Robson stated that one of the reasons why the 18-year-old has become a force to reckon with is because of having a ‘good head’ on his shoulders.

“Fonseca, meanwhile, got everyone excited in Australia, because he plays such a big brand of tennis for an 18-year-old - his forehand is absolutely huge - and the shot-making is what gets people fired up,” she wrote. “It was just an amazing week for him to get his first ATP title in Argentina this month, and hopefully he can build on that momentum going forward. I first saw him play in person [when tournament director] at Nottingham last year. He ended up losing to Billy Harris in a match that started on grass and finished indoors… We ended up having to move them as it was the only second round that hadn't finished yet due to horrific British weather. After what was a tough day for him he still came and said thank you to everyone that worked for the tournament. He's got a really good head on his shoulders, and you want to see someone like that do well. So since last summer, I've been a big fan, and have been hoping to see that breakthrough.”
